Yuliy Pavlov

Python Software Engineer
Yuliy Pavlov
Python Software Engineer
Ташкент
+998 91 019 01 46
+998 91 019 01 46
Специализации

Разработка сайтов
Разработка приложений

Навыки

Python
PostgreSQL
Agile Project Management
Django
REST API
SQL
Nginx
CICD
Redis
OOP
Git
Postman

Обо мне

Backend developer in Python with hands-on experience in developing web services using Django and FastAPI, designing REST APIs, working with PostgreSQL, containerization (Docker), deploying applications using Gunicorn/Uvicorn, Nginx, and CI/CD. Configured authentication and authorization (JWT), wrote unit and integration tests (Pytest).

Portfolio

  • Recipe sharing platform

    None

    • Developed and launched a service with subscription functionality and automatic PDF report generation for product lists. • Optimized database performance by eliminating the N+1 problem using select_related and prefetch_related, speeding up API response time by 40%. • Fully automated CI/CD processes through GitHub Actions, setting up a pipeline for testing, image building, and deployment to a remote server. Stack: Python, Django, PostgreSQL, REST API (DRF), Docker, Nginx, Gunicorn, JWT, Postman.

Education

  • Kutafin Moscow State Law University

    Магистратура

    1 октября 2015 г. - 1 июня 2017 г.
  • Yandex EdTech

    Школа / Professional Retraining Diploma in Python Development

    1 июня 2023 г. - 1 марта 2024 г.

Work Experience

  • Python Developer

    Product Development

    1 сентября 2024 г. - None